What are the considerations for purchasing cinema equipment?
浏览次数: 次 来源:未知

  First, the present cinema projection equipment is divided into film type and digital type. Looking at the development trend in the future, digital movies are definitely in the ascendant.

 
 
 
2. The projectors used in cinemas are definitely not 1080p projectors for household use, but professional digital movie projectors. Now the major brands involved are NEC SONY, Video DP Barco and so on. These brands are also used in relatively low-end occasions. High-end digital cinema projectors have very high brightness, generally more than 10,000 lumens, even up to 30,000 lumens. At the lower end, there are more than 5000 lumens, while the brightness of the ordinary commercial education projector is only about 2000 lumens.
 
 
 
3. Chips are also different. Many digital projectors using DLP technology are 3D MD chips. 3LCD chips are basically difficult, because the bulb temperature is very high, which may melt the LCD panel. The price of a 3D MD chip is very, very expensive.
 
 
 
4. Resolution is very particular. The resolution of digital movies can be divided into 4K, 2k, 1.3k and 0.8k from high to low.

Now Hollywood's demand for cinemas is 2K. Although 4K projectors and even 8K chips are available, few 4K film sources are available.
 
 
 
5. Contrast is not very high. Now the contrast of 1080p projectors at home has reached 1 million:1. The contrast of 1080p projectors at low-end entry level is also everywhere, but the contrast of digital projectors is much lower. The contrast of 2000:1 is also very common.

Cinema Audio System

 Since Dolby's film stereo was introduced into China in 1995, the domestic film stereo industry has made great progress, especially the development of digital film, which has greatly promoted the progress of film science and technology in China. Nowadays, most of the city cinemas in our country have been transformed into SR stereo or digital stereo cinemas. The improvement of cinema acoustic surroundings and the improvement of sound system quality have been paid more and more attention. Cinema acoustics system covers a wide range of areas. It includes architectural acoustics design and all sound-return systems and their designs in cinemas. This paper only discusses the basic characteristics of the B-ring part of the film sound-returning system, power amplifier and loudspeaker, and the design method of sound field. At the same time, it introduces the stereo power amplifier and loudspeaker used in cinemas in China at present.

 
 
 
1. Basic Technical Characteristics of Power Amplifier
 
 
 
The function of power amplifier is to amplify the decoded and balanced audio signals and to promote the sound supply of loudspeakers. In stereo film playback technology, the requirement of power amplifier is high efficiency, low distortion, high power and high fidelity. It ensures that the sound playback has enough power and can truthfully reflect the sound quality and timbre of audio signal. To master the technical performance of power amplifier is the necessary condition for the correct selection and use of power amplifier, and the frequency response and distortion should also be considered.
 
 
 
2. Frequency response
 
 
 
Frequency response should consider two indicators: gain-frequency response and distortion-frequency response.
 
 
 
Gain-frequency response refers to the amplification ability of each frequency component of power amplifier. It shows the frequency characteristics of the power amplifier, that is, the bandwidth of the amplifier and the non-uniformity of the magnification in the bandwidth. Although the audible acoustic response ranges from 20 kHz to 20 kHz, in order to reduce distortion, the bandwidth of the amplifier is extended to 10 kHz to 100 kHz, and the non-uniformity is less than 1 dB.
 
 
 
3. Distortion
 
 
 
Distortion refers to the non-linear distortion of power amplifier. Considering static index, harmonic distortion, crossover distortion, clipping distortion, phase distortion and intermodulation distortion, dynamic index has transient intermodulation distortion and so on. For transistor power amplifiers, only a considerable amount of negative feedback is added to achieve a fairly high level of harmonic distortion (currently it can be reduced to less than 0.01%). However, even if the harmonic distortion is very small, the sound stiffness and high frequency hair are still felt in the subjective hearing, which is not as good as the quality of the tube power amplifier which is two grades lower than it. This is because the over-load distortion of the transistor power amplifier is hard. As shown in Figure 3, after the over-load point, the non-linear distortion increases rapidly, and the output waveform is cut like a knife. The over-load curve of the transistor power amplifier is relatively flat, but the output waveform distortion is still radian. Because there are many impulse components in modern music, in order to obtain good sound quality, transistor power amplifier should have larger output power. Usually, its output power is at least two times larger than that of electron tube power amplifier.
